Who was the leader of Tammany Hall (New York Political Machine)?

Back

William Tweed was the leader of Tammany Hall, a powerful political machine in New York City during the 19th century.

What was Custer's Last Stand?

Back

Custer's Last Stand, also known as the Battle of Little Bighorn, was the worst US Army defeat by Native Americans, leading to a significant push to move Native Americans to reservations.

What is the Open Door Policy?

Back

The Open Door Policy was a diplomatic policy that allowed the United States and other nations to trade openly with China and other countries, promoting equal trading rights.

What role did the alliance system play in World War I?

Back

The alliance system was a key factor that escalated the conflict from a bilateral dispute between Austria-Hungary and Serbia into a full-scale world war.

What is the Sherman Anti-Trust Act?

Back

The Sherman Anti-Trust Act is a federal law that aimed to eliminate trusts and monopolies, promoting competition in the marketplace.

Define 'Political Machine'.

Back

A political machine is a political organization that commands enough votes to maintain control of a city, county, or state, often characterized by corruption and patronage.
